Constructed of silvered and patinated tombak, the obverse consisting of an oval laurel and oak leaf wreath, joined together at the bottom by ribbon, overlaid by a swooping Luftwaffe eagle, the reverse with a raised crimped barrel hinge and vertical pinback meeting a flat wire catch, with two visible rivets securing the obverse eagle in place, unmarked, measuring 65. 53 mm (w) x 53. 34 mm (h), weighing 43. 4 grams,
